Bridge health monitoring support and monitoring system
The invention discloses a bridge health monitoring support and a monitoring system, which are used to solve the problems that manual detection of a bridge support located in a hidden and severe engineering environment is inconvenient, all-weather monitoring cannot be achieved by manual periodic detection, meanwhile, the number of bridge supports is large, the manual detection period is long, and the safety problem of the bridge is difficult to judge. A health monitoring support group is composed of a plurality of health monitoring supports. The health monitoring support is composed of a functional part, an optical fiber force measuring sensor, a displacement sensor and an inclination angle sensor. The functional part is composed of a lower support plate, a spherical crown lining plate, anupper support plate, a plane sliding plate, a sealing ring, a plane sliding plate, a middle plate, a wedge-shaped ring, an upper support plate, a middle plate, a wedge-shaped ring and a lower supportplate. The displacement sensor and the inclination angle sensor are in transmission and connection with a monitoring and collecting center through optical fibers.
